Output 24765fba229455bf344ee7a0455f6ffd377720f2e8038d17e0d24e6428873d6e:0

value
28064
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d156742343ea2657e366b7b4cab706fd90077993211b07c0640bafc99fad685
address
bc1p052kws35863x2l3kdda5e2msdlvsqauexggmqlqxgza0ex0666zs4hm4k9
transaction
24765fba229455bf344ee7a0455f6ffd377720f2e8038d17e0d24e6428873d6e
confirmations
128649
spent
true